Browse code

Attempt to fix SunC build: enum/unsigned mismatch is not allowed.

Török Edvin authored on 2009/12/12 21:45:55
Showing 2 changed files
... ...
@@ -122,7 +122,7 @@ void cli_bytecode_debug_printsrc(const struct cli_bc_ctx *ctx);
122 122
 typedef void (*bc_dbg_callback_trace)(struct cli_bc_ctx*, unsigned event);
123 123
 typedef void (*bc_dbg_callback_trace_op)(struct cli_bc_ctx*, const char *op);
124 124
 typedef void (*bc_dbg_callback_trace_val)(struct cli_bc_ctx*, const char *name, uint32_t value);
125
-void cli_bytecode_context_set_trace(struct cli_bc_ctx*, unsigned mask,
125
+void cli_bytecode_context_set_trace(struct cli_bc_ctx*, unsigned level,
126 126
 				    bc_dbg_callback_trace,
127 127
 				    bc_dbg_callback_trace_op,
128 128
 				    bc_dbg_callback_trace_val);
... ...
@@ -139,7 +139,7 @@ int32_t cli_bcapi_write(struct cli_bc_ctx *ctx, uint8_t*data, int32_t len)
139 139
     return res;
140 140
 }
141 141
 
142
-void cli_bytecode_context_set_trace(struct cli_bc_ctx* ctx, enum trace_level level,
142
+void cli_bytecode_context_set_trace(struct cli_bc_ctx* ctx, unsigned level,
143 143
 				    bc_dbg_callback_trace trace,
144 144
 				    bc_dbg_callback_trace_op trace_op,
145 145
 				    bc_dbg_callback_trace_val trace_val)